NESCAFE
Nescafé, the iconic instant coffee brand
owned by Nestlé, has firmly established
itself as a global market leader. Its
widespread brand recognition, diverse
product portfolio, and sustainability
initiatives position it for continued
success despite competitive threats.

1 Rising Competition
Nescafé faces increasing competition from specialty coffee
brands, single-serve coffee systems, and local artisanal roasters
2
Health Consciousness
Evolving consumer preferences towards healthier, organic,
and environmentally-friendly products pose a challenge for
Nescafé's traditional instant coffee offerings
3 Pricing Pressure
The competitive landscape and growing consumer demand for
premium coffee may put downward pressure on Nescafé's pricing
and profit margins.
